头部显示用户名称错误

This commit is contained in:
pushuo 2022-08-10 14:06:21 +08:00
parent 476a7c89dc
commit 7310e822c5
1 changed files with 50 additions and 32 deletions

View File

@ -14,7 +14,9 @@
<div class="dropdown-menu" aria-labelledby="currency-dropdown">
@foreach (currencies() as $currency)
<a class="dropdown-item" href="{{ shop_route('currency.switch', [$currency->code]) }}">{{ $currency->symbol_left }} {{ $currency->name }}</a>
<a class="dropdown-item"
href="{{ shop_route('currency.switch', [$currency->code]) }}">{{ $currency->symbol_left }}
{{ $currency->name }}</a>
@endforeach
</div>
</div>
@ -26,7 +28,8 @@
<div class="dropdown-menu" aria-labelledby="language-dropdown">
@foreach ($languages as $language)
<a class="dropdown-item" href="{{ shop_route('lang.switch', [$language->code]) }}">{{ $language->name }}</a>
<a class="dropdown-item"
href="{{ shop_route('lang.switch', [$language->code]) }}">{{ $language->name }}</a>
@endforeach
</div>
</div>
@ -41,52 +44,67 @@
<div class="header-content py-3">
<div class="container navbar-expand-lg">
<div class="logo"><a href="{{ shop_route('home.index') }}"><img src="{{ asset('image/logo.png') }}" class="img-fluid"></a></div>
<div class="logo"><a href="{{ shop_route('home.index') }}"><img src="{{ asset('image/logo.png') }}"
class="img-fluid"></a></div>
<div class="menu-wrap">
<ul class="navbar-nav mx-auto">
@foreach ($categories as $category)
<li class="dropdown">
<a
target="{{ (isset($category['new_window']) and $category['new_window']) ? '_blank' : '_self' }}"
class="nav-link {{ (isset($category['children']) and $category['children']) ? 'dropdown-toggle' : '' }}"
href="{{ $category['url'] }}">
{{ $category['name'] }}
</a>
@if (isset($category['children']) and $category['children'])
<ul class="dropdown-menu">
@forelse ($category['children'] as $child)
<li><a target="{{ (isset($child['new_window']) and $child['new_window']) ? '_blank' : '_self' }}" href="{{ $child['url'] }}" class="dropdown-item">{{ $child['name'] }}</a></li>
@endforeach
</ul>
@endif
</li>
<li class="dropdown">
<a target="{{ (isset($category['new_window']) and $category['new_window']) ? '_blank' : '_self' }}"
class="nav-link {{ (isset($category['children']) and $category['children']) ? 'dropdown-toggle' : '' }}"
href="{{ $category['url'] }}">
{{ $category['name'] }}
</a>
@if (isset($category['children']) and $category['children'])
<ul class="dropdown-menu">
@forelse ($category['children'] as $child)
<li><a target="{{ (isset($child['new_window']) and $child['new_window']) ? '_blank' : '_self' }}"
href="{{ $child['url'] }}" class="dropdown-item">{{ $child['name'] }}</a></li>
@endforeach
</ul>
@endif
</li>
@endforeach
</ul>
{{-- <a href="{{ shop_route('categories.show', $category) }}">{{ $category->description->name }}</a> --}}
{{-- <a href="{{ shop_route('categories.show', $category) }}">{{ $category->description->name }}</a> --}}
</div>
<div class="right-btn">
<ul class="navbar-nav flex-row">
<li class="nav-item"><a href="#offcanvas-search-top" data-bs-toggle="offcanvas" aria-controls="offcanvasExample" class="nav-link"><i class="iconfont">&#xe8d6;</i></a></li>
<li class="nav-item"><a href="{{ shop_route('account.wishlist.index') }}" class="nav-link"><i class="iconfont">&#xe662;</i></a></li>
<li class="nav-item"><a href="#offcanvas-search-top" data-bs-toggle="offcanvas"
aria-controls="offcanvasExample" class="nav-link"><i class="iconfont">&#xe8d6;</i></a></li>
<li class="nav-item"><a href="{{ shop_route('account.wishlist.index') }}" class="nav-link"><i
class="iconfont">&#xe662;</i></a></li>
<li class="nav-item dropdown">
<a href="{{ shop_route('account.index') }}" class="nav-link"><i class="iconfont">&#xe619;</i></a>
<ul class="dropdown-menu dropdown-menu-end">
@auth('web_shop')
<li class="dropdown-item"><h6 class="mb-0">Pu Shuo</h6></li>
<li><hr class="dropdown-divider"></li>
<li><a href="{{ shop_route('account.index') }}" class="dropdown-item"><i class="bi bi-person me-1"></i> 个人中心</a></li>
<li><a href="{{ shop_route('account.order.index') }}" class="dropdown-item"><i class="bi bi-clipboard-check me-1"></i> 我的订单</a></li>
<li><a href="{{ shop_route('account.wishlist.index') }}" class="dropdown-item"><i class="bi bi-heart me-1"></i> 我的收藏</a></li>
<li><hr class="dropdown-divider"></li>
<li><a href="{{ shop_route('logout') }}" class="dropdown-item"><i class="bi bi-box-arrow-left me-1"></i> 退出登录</a></li>
<li class="dropdown-item">
<h6 class="mb-0">{{ current_customer()->name }}</h6>
</li>
<li>
<hr class="dropdown-divider">
</li>
<li><a href="{{ shop_route('account.index') }}" class="dropdown-item"><i class="bi bi-person me-1"></i>
个人中心</a></li>
<li><a href="{{ shop_route('account.order.index') }}" class="dropdown-item"><i
class="bi bi-clipboard-check me-1"></i> 我的订单</a></li>
<li><a href="{{ shop_route('account.wishlist.index') }}" class="dropdown-item"><i
class="bi bi-heart me-1"></i> 我的收藏</a></li>
<li>
<hr class="dropdown-divider">
</li>
<li><a href="{{ shop_route('logout') }}" class="dropdown-item"><i class="bi bi-box-arrow-left me-1"></i>
退出登录</a></li>
@else
<li><a href="{{ shop_route('login.index') }}" class="dropdown-item"><i class="bi bi-box-arrow-right me-1"></i> 登录/注册</a></li>
<li><a href="{{ shop_route('login.index') }}" class="dropdown-item"><i
class="bi bi-box-arrow-right me-1"></i> 登录/注册</a></li>
@endauth
</ul>
</li>
<li class="nav-item">
<a class="nav-link" data-bs-toggle="offcanvas" href="#offcanvas-right-cart" role="button" aria-controls="offcanvasExample">
<a class="nav-link" data-bs-toggle="offcanvas" href="#offcanvas-right-cart" role="button"
aria-controls="offcanvasExample">
<i class="iconfont">&#xe634;</i>
<div class="navbar-icon-link-badge"></div>
</a>
@ -118,9 +136,9 @@
<div class="offcanvas offcanvas-top" tabindex="-1" id="offcanvas-search-top" aria-labelledby="offcanvasTopLabel">
<div class="offcanvas-header">
<input type="text" class="form-control input-group-lg border-0 fs-4" focus placeholder="Type your search here" aria-label="Type your search here" aria-describedby="button-addon2">
<input type="text" class="form-control input-group-lg border-0 fs-4" focus
placeholder="Type your search here" aria-label="Type your search here" aria-describedby="button-addon2">
<button type="button" class="btn-close text-reset" data-bs-dismiss="offcanvas" aria-label="Close"></button>
</div>
</div>
</header>